【发布时间】:2022-02-25 10:48:25
【问题描述】:
命令“npm run serve”不起作用,我明白了:
npm 错误!代码 ENOENT
npm 错误!系统调用打开
npm 错误!路径 C:\Users\user/package.json
npm 错误!错误号 -4058
npm 错误! enoent ENOENT:没有这样的文件或目录,打开 'C:\Users\user\package.json'
npm 错误! enoent 这与 npm 找不到文件有关。
npm 错误!埃诺特
npm 错误!可以在以下位置找到此运行的完整日志:br npm 错误! C:\Users\user\AppData\Local\npm-cache_logs\2022-02-24T23_43_08_331Z-debug-0.log
我尝试重新安装/安装节点 npm,我尝试过但没有工作:
npm config set ignore-scripts false
【问题讨论】:
-
看起来您正在从没有 package.json 的目录运行
npm run serve。您将需要位于具有 package.json 的目录中,该目录具有"scripts"section 并指定了"serve"脚本。您很可能需要进入项目目录并再次运行命令。您可能需要先运行npm install,具体取决于您的依赖项是否已安装。